Barreiro scored a hat-trick in Benfica's 4-0 win over Famalicão on matchday 18 of the Liga Betclic.
17 January 2025, 23h55
Barreiro scored a hat-trick
In a quick interview with BTV's microphone at the end of the match, which Benfica won 4-0, the hero of the night commented on the unprecedented feat. "I think I'm still dreaming, to be honest... Wow, I don't even know what to say! Scoring three goals... I'd already scored one goal in a game in my career, but now three in one game, I don't even know what to say," he started by saying, and then explain how a defensive midfielder scored a perfect hat-trick, without any other goal - either by an opponent or a teammate - interrupting the triple streak: "After the first one, there was an action, I scored the second one, and then my teammates were already saying 'Look, go for the third one, go for the third one'. There are days like this, I'm very happy."
BARREIRO'S HAT-TRICK
Although the moment is special and deserves to be savored, Barreiro has already focused on next Tuesday's European mission, the match against Barcelona on matchday 7 of the Champions League, emphasizing this season's motto: Everyone counts!
"We won today, it was very important to do our job, but in a few days we have another important game in the Champions League, and we need everyone - us on the pitch and the fans outside - to support us in the easy moments, but also in the less good moments, as I've also said on my social media, we need everyone," stressed the number 18.
